Choosing the Right Silhouette

The first step in your dress hunt is figuring out which silhouette flatters your body type and matches your personal style. An A-line dress is a classic choice that’s fitted at the hips and gradually widens towards the hem, creating a beautiful and comfortable shape. For a more dramatic and glamorous look, a mermaid or trumpet style hugs your body before flaring out at the bottom. If you're aiming for modern and sleek, a sheath dress that follows your natural curves can be a stunning option. Don't be afraid to try on several different styles to see what makes you feel most confident.

The Importance of Fabric

The fabric of your dress plays a huge role in its overall look and feel. A satin or silk black dress offers a luxurious sheen that catches the light beautifully, perfect for a formal event. Velvet provides a rich, plush texture that’s both elegant and unique. For a touch of romance, consider a dress with lace overlays or chiffon layers that add softness and movement. The material can transform a simple black dress into a show-stopping piece, so consider how it drapes and feels.

Accessorizing Your Black Dress

One of the best things about a black dress is its versatility when it comes to accessories. You have a blank slate to create a look that is uniquely you. You can opt for classic elegance with pearl or diamond jewelry, or make a bold statement with colorful gems or chunky metallic pieces. Your shoes can either be a subtle complement, like silver or black heels, or a pop of color that stands out. Hair and Makeup to Complete the Look

Your hair and makeup are the final touches that tie your entire prom look together. With a black dress, you have endless possibilities. A classic red lip and winged eyeliner create a timeless, Hollywood-glam vibe. A smoky eye can add a touch of drama and mystery. When it comes to your hair, consider the neckline of your dress. An updo beautifully showcases a dress with an intricate back or neckline, while soft waves can complement a simpler, more romantic style. The key is to choose a look that makes you feel comfortable and confident.
